Kaye Lamb Sent: Thursday, April 20, 2006 8:57 AM To: [log in to unmask] Subject: [Arcan-l] 2006 ACA Institute: Archives in the Wake of Hugh Taylor: Dear Archival Colleagues, I invite you to attend the Association of Canadian Archivists' Institute, "Archives in the Wake of Hugh Taylor: Shaping Archival Programmes for the 21st Century", in St. John's Newfoundland, June 26-27, 2006. The Institute promises to be excellent. Inspired by Canada's premier archival thinker, Hugh Taylor, this Institute will offer participants an overview of how archiving could be conceived and done in new ways. The 2006 ACA Institute will be led by two W. Kaye Lamb Award winning archivists, Terry Cook and Tom Nesmith, both professors in Archival Studies at the University of Manitoba. Participants will also receive a copy of "Imagining Archives: Essays and Reflections by Hugh A. Taylor"(2003, edited by Terry Cook and Gordon Dodds).
